#38b2ac h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#38b2ac is composed of 22% red, 69.8% green and 67.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 3.4%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 177 degrees, a saturation of 52.1% and a lightness of 45.9%. #38b2ac color hex could be obtained by blending #70ffff with #006559.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

● #38b2ac color description : Dark moderate cyan.
The hexadecimal color #38b2ac has RGB values of R:56, G:178, B:172 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.03,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 3715756.
